Default K&B 61 Gold Head

I recently got a new in the box K & B 61 gold head. I believe it was called the twister. On the mounting lug is G97 61. Hand written on the inside of the box is "Last one produced in the K&B factory under Wisnewski's supervision". Can anyone give me info on this engine? When it was built? Is it in fact the last one?

The "Twister 61" was offered during Bill Bennett's ownership of K&B. They like big props and are timed much like the Sportster Series. I don't know if they were manufactured after MECOA purchased K&B or they just assembled them from parts to sell. Currently, the "Twister 61" is discontinued and will be replaced by the new 99-5102 K&B 61 ABC. The new offering will be going to a new case design and more traditional Head arrangement. This info comes from CF Lee as he has been trying to get Mecoa to change the head design for years. The engine is very lite weight and can swing 13 & 14 inch props.
